I tried yesterday to creat an anim file using IFX4.5. (4.5 doesn't seem to come with it's own booklet.  I got the book for 4.0 and my original 3.0 book.  [I guess I should hunt around for the docs on the CD].)

I was wondering if someone can tell me what I'm doing wrong?

I've got 2 images (they are 24bit iff images [which might be my problem right there?]).  They ar both the same size 180x151.  I load the first image, open the layers menu, select "create new frame" [only anim related menu option], then select "load frame" and load in my second image.  I've got 3 images, delete the extreneous one.

I then click on each image and set the "rate".

Then I try and select "Save as sequence..." and select "Anim".  I get an error stating the that images need to have a colormap?  I thought it might be an error because I'm using 24 bit images, so for fun I select "gif" and it says I've got the wrong colour depth.

Both .anim and .gif are colormapped formats and have fewer colors than the 24 bit images in your buffer.

Image FX needs you to convert the buffer to colormapped images first.  It's very powerful but you need to know some stuff about formats and stuff to use it.

Open the "Color" requestor with the button on the toolbar.
There you'll see "Convert to CMAP" fifth from the bottom.
(Make sure you have your animated buffer selected first.) Click on it and you'll get some options....choose what you want and it will convert all the frames in your anim buffer to colormapped frames.  Then you can save to either .anim or .gif.

BTW, you can save 24 bit animations in the native Image FX format of INGF.

first off, a "Sequence" means separate frames, or files that are numbered sequentially. this is not what you want. the menu from the layers menu window will only save sequences.

if you want to save an ANIM (a single file of compressed frames all together in a lump), you have to use the normal SAVE button on the toolbox.

now, a gif anim is a colormapped image (256 colors or less). gif can never be 24 bit. The only time amigas can make 24 bit "anims is when you make a flyer clip. and that generally happens (i believe) if you have a flyer. I'm guessing you don't  :-P

mpgs and such are also 24bit but you have to compile separate single frames together to get them into that format. IFX doesn't really directly save to mpg. you can, save the 24 bit frames from IFX.

if you have enough memory you can play the anim from the layers menu. but that doesn't have anything to do with saving. just thought i'd point it out. :lol:
